Overview
Indico
Indico is:
a general-purpose event management tool;
fully web-based;
feature-rich but also extensible through the use of plugins;
Open-Source Software under the MIT License;
made at CERN, the place where the web was born!
What does it do?
Indico’s main features are:
- a powerful and flexible hierarchical content management system for events;
- a full-blown conference organization workflow with:
Call for Abstracts and abstract reviewing modules;
flexible registration form creation and configuration;
integration with existing payment systems;
a paper reviewing workflow;
a drag and drop timetable management interface;
a simple badge editor with the possibility to print badges and tickets for participants;
- tools for meeting management and archival of presentation materials;
- a powerful room booking interface;
- integration with existing video conferencing solutions;

Developer info
Please send your pull request to the testing
branch.
To try the testing
branch, please proceed like that:
sudo yunohost app install https://github.com/YunoHost-Apps/indico_ynh/tree/testing --debug
or
sudo yunohost app upgrade indico -u https://github.com/YunoHost-Apps/indico_ynh/tree/testing --debug
